Abstract:
[ Abstract] Vitamin D is a steroid derivative. It has the effect of regulating calcium -phosphorus metabolism. With the development of medicine, the effects of vitamin D in other respects, such as regulation of blood pressure, blood glucose, nerve protection, and immunity have received more and more attention. A lot of research show s that the level of vitamin D is closely associated w ith the onset and outcome of ischemic stroke. In addition, some researchers explored the relationship betw een vitamin D and stroke from the genetic perspective. How ever, the existing research results are not consistent. The link betw een vitamin D and ischemic stroke is not clear. This article review s the correlation studies of the relationship among vitamin D and vitamin D receptor gene polymorphism, the onset of ischemic stroke, outcomes and risk factors in recent years.
